Batting in VR Cricket Epic Encounter

Batting is where VR Cricket Epic Encounter truly shines. The game's motion tracking technology translates your real-world movements into in-game actions with impressive accuracy. To hit a shot, you simply swing your virtual bat (held in your hand via the VR controller) as you would in real life.

Different types of shots require different techniques. A straight drive, for example, requires a full, fluid swing with your front foot forward, while a pull shot needs a quick, powerful movement to send the ball to the leg side. The game rewards timing and technique, just like real cricket.

One of the most praised features of the batting system is the "feel" of hitting the ball. Depending on where the ball hits the bat, you'll feel a slight vibration in the controller, giving you feedback on the quality of your shot. Hit the sweet spot, and you'll feel a satisfying buzz as the ball sails towards the boundary.

As you progress in the game, you'll unlock new batting techniques and power-ups, such as the "Desi Dhamaka" shot—a special power hit inspired by Indian batsmen known for their explosive batting style. These power-ups add an extra layer of excitement to the gameplay, especially in high-pressure situations.

Bowling in VR Cricket Epic Encounter

Bowling in VR Cricket Epic Encounter is equally immersive. Whether you're a fast bowler, a spinner, or somewhere in between, the game lets you replicate the actions of your favorite bowlers with precision.

Fast bowlers will need to master their run-up (controlled by moving in place or using the controller's joystick) and deliver a smooth, powerful action to generate pace. The game measures the speed of your bowling based on the speed of your arm movement, with top speeds reaching up to 150 km/h for elite players.

Spin bowlers, on the other hand, can impart spin on the ball by twisting their wrist at the point of delivery. The type of spin (leg spin, off spin, googly) depends on the angle of your wrist and the movement of your fingers, giving you full control over how the ball behaves after it hits the pitch.

Just like in real cricket, bowling in VR Cricket Epic Encounter requires strategy. You'll need to read the batsman's weaknesses, vary your pace and spin, and target specific areas of the pitch to increase your chances of taking wickets.

Batting Tips from Indian Pros

Indian cricket is known for its aggressive yet technically sound batting, and these tips from top Indian players of VR Cricket Epic Encounter reflect that style:

1. Master the Cover Drive: The cover drive is a staple of Indian batting, and it's equally effective in the game. To perfect it, ensure your front foot moves forward and across, and swing the bat with a full follow-through. This shot is particularly effective against medium-paced bowlers on good pitches.

2. Use the Wrists for Flicks: Indian batsmen are famous for their wristy flicks to the leg side. In the game, this shot can be deadly against fast bowlers bowling full. Focus on flicking your wrists at the last moment, rather than swinging hard, to direct the ball past square leg or fine leg.

3. Read the Bowler's Action: In VR Cricket Epic Encounter, bowlers have distinct actions that can give away their delivery. Spend time watching the bowler's run-up and arm movement—you'll soon learn to spot when a fast bowler is going to bowl a short ball or a spinner is preparing to bowl a googly.

4. Build an Innings in Test Mode: Test cricket requires patience, and the same applies in the game's Test mode. Focus on rotating the strike and only going for big shots when the ball is in your zone. This approach will help you build large scores and win matches.

5. Practice Against Spin: Spin bowling is a big part of Indian cricket, and the game features some challenging spin bowlers. Spend time in the practice nets facing different spin types, learning to pick the spin early and adjust your shot accordingly.

Bowling Strategies for Indian Conditions

Bowling in Indian conditions—whether real or virtual—requires a different approach than bowling in other parts of the world. Here are some tips from India's top VR Cricket Epic Encounter bowlers:

1. Variation is Key for Fast Bowlers: Indian pitches often offer less bounce and pace, so fast bowlers need to rely on variation. Mix up your pace—bowl a few slower balls among your faster deliveries to keep batsmen guessing. Swing and seam can also be effective, especially in the early overs.

2. Spin Bowlers: Focus on Length and Turn: Spin is king in India, and the game reflects that. As a spinner, aim to land the ball just outside the off stump (for off-spinners) or leg stump (for leg-spinners) and vary the amount of turn you put on the ball. A well-disguised googly or doosra can be a match-winner.

3. Bowl to the Field: In VR Cricket Epic Encounter, as in real cricket, your bowling should be guided by your field placement. If you have a deep square leg fielder, bowl shorter to encourage the batsman to pull, increasing the chance of a catch. If you have a slip fielder, aim for the outside edge with a good length ball.

4. Target the Toes: Yorker deliveries are particularly effective in Indian conditions, where batsmen often look to play across the line. Practice your yorker in the nets—if you can land it consistently, you'll take plenty of wickets, especially in T20 matches.

5. Use the Weather: The game includes dynamic weather conditions, which affect the ball's behavior. In humid conditions (common in many parts of India), the ball swings more—use this to your advantage as a fast bowler. In dry conditions, spin bowlers will get more turn.
